Computers

QuestionAnswer
Computer A machine you can program Started around (1940-1945)
Personal Computer Short name (pc)
Hardware Equipment attached to a computer example CD drive, Speakers ect.
Software Set of instructions for the computer that has the ability to manage a computer. Example Microsoft Word.
Monitor Display screen
Mouse Input device, moves the cursor on the monitor
Keyboard Set of keys or buttons that are used to input information and instructions to a computer.
Hard Drive Storage devise of a computer where OS and aplications and data are kept
CDROM Compact disk read only memory
CDROM Drive Pit you insert the cd in
